Output a8f7524a17355db675fa2fa810a5a96a092d3efb5677d8bf7a66c79698fd4f6a:1

value
664573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ec50c017ff13fd543d63ff9ab188832121e102 OP_EQUALVERIFY OP_CHECKSIG
address
18UAq2HvL531ZSixRoce4Dn6Hm2eb2bQ82
transaction
a8f7524a17355db675fa2fa810a5a96a092d3efb5677d8bf7a66c79698fd4f6a
spent
true